2012-05-21 2 views
0

사용자가 데이터 집합에서 삽입, 업데이트, 편집 및 삭제 취소 (CRUD) 기능을 필요로하는 웹 응용 프로그램 (C#) 요구 사항이 있습니다. 데이터 소스의 한 레코드는 필드 수로 인해 두 (또는 세) 행에 걸쳐 표시되어야합니다. GridView는 한 행을 스패닝 할 수있는 기능을 제공하지 못합니다. DataList에는 삽입 기능이 없습니다. 내가 찾은 확장 가능한 GridView 예제에는 편집 가능한 내용이 없습니다. 나는 성공하지 않고 여러 유형의 컨트롤로이 요구 사항을 달성하기 위해 여러 가지 방법을 시도해 왔습니다. 어떤 도움이라도 대단히 감사합니다.여러 행에 걸쳐 표시되는 편집 가능 (삽입 포함) 데이터 소스

답변

0

DataGrid는 필요한 것을 제공해야합니다. TemplateColumns를 사용하여 지정된 셀이 페이지에 렌더링되는 방식을 정의 할 수 있습니다.

이 링크는 필요한 정보를 제공합니다. http://www.asp.net/web-forms/tutorials/data-access/custom-formatting/using-templatefields-in-the-gridview-control-cs

이렇게하면 유연성이 충분하지 않으면 DataRepeater 컨트롤에서 사용자가 직접 눈금을 렌더링 할 수 있도록 모든 권한을 제공합니다.

관련 문제